LOKI'S WOLVES by K. L. Armstrong and M. A. Marr is a delightful tale of mythology, coming of age, and magic! Blackwell is a place where the long decedents of Thor and Loki live. Throughout this excellently written story we follow the adventures of Matthew Thorson and Fen and Laurie Brekke as they take on their destiny and try to save the world.
Matthew Thorson is a decedent of Thor, and has just been named the Champion of Thor. We follow Matt as he figures out what that entails, and how he is supposed to go about changing his destiny. Matt's first quest is to locate the other champions then collect the items he needs to fight the Midgard Serpent and stop RagnarΓΆk, the end of the world.
LOKI'S WOLVES is by far one of the most entertaining and enlightening tales I have read in quite a while. Armstong and Marr have done such a wonderful job intertwining mythology into this story that any young reader will learn a great deal as well as have a delightful tale running through their minds. LOKI'S WOLVES is a story for the ages, it is one that many a generation could enjoy and learn a lot from. It is a great story and I really cannot wait for the next.
